Cap,
The procedure you are referring to pertains only to geared traction elevators. It will only stop the sheave (wheel) from moving, it will not stop the cables from sliding through the grooves of the sheave. I wrote an article for FireEngineering magazine(December, 2007 issue) that describes an incident that I was involved in where the cables slipped through the groves of the machine. This is a pratice that we no longer use.
